The Elevate Aluminium commercial range of windows and doors from Architectural Window Systems was selected for a new home built on a spectacular rural property in the picturesque hamlet of Willow Vale, NSW.

Located at the foothills of the NSW Southern Highlands, the property, formerly the site of a 100-year-old dairy farm, delivers stunning views alongside a homely country atmosphere. Designed by The Pole Home Center and built by Quine Building, the 207-square-metre home is surrounded by elegant landscaped gardens and also has beautiful ocean views. Seeking to maintain the character and history of the site, the owners worked closely with the architects on the design and build process. The dairy farm was carefully dismantled brick by brick and the historic bricks re-laid as an upcycled foyer and feature walls within the home.

The owners also wanted to maximise views of the rural landscape gardens and the ocean; since privacy was not an issue, the property being a rural site, the owners opted for the inclusion of large bold fixed windows throughout the home to make the most of their ocean views and beautiful landscaped countryside.

Quine Building leveraged their longstanding relationship with local window and door fabricator Hanlon Windows to achieve a superb glazing outcome for the project. Having worked with Hanlon Windows as well as the Vantage and Elevate product ranges for many years, Stuart Quine from Quine Building was confident about the selection from the Elevate commercial platform to make the windows a feature of the home.

The Elevate Aluminium commercial range of windows and doors incorporates strong bold frames and heavy duty commercial grade rollers, hinges and hardware, ensuring smooth operation as well as long term durability. Commercial frame profiles allow for wider windows and doors, a perfect solution for this project where maximising views was a priority. With the flexibility to accept a range of glazing platforms, Stuart worked closely with the team at Hanlon Windows to determine the right glass and frame combination for each elevation of the home.

AWS windows ensured excellent energy efficiency and thermal performance, allowing the home to meet all BASIX energy requirements.

AWS products used in the project included CentreGLAZED framing, large SlideMASTER sliding doors, double hung windows, louvres and commercial hinged doors, all fitted with a variety of Viridian high performance glass combinations. The windows and doors are powder coated in white, creating a lovely and timeless country feel against the grey weatherboard cladding of the home.
